Tired Federer to skip Shanghai Masters

Tired Federer to skip Shanghai MastersLondon: World number three Roger Federer has pulled out of next month`s Shanghai Masters to rest and recover after a gruelling summer, the Association of Tennis Professionals (ATP) said on Friday.

"After consultation with my team, I`ve unfortunately decided to pull out of the Shanghai Masters in order to take some necessary time to rest and recuperate after a long summer," the Swiss maestro was quoted as saying on the ATP website (www.atpworldtour.com).

"I have some nagging injuries that I need to address and I look forward to returning to the ATP World Tour as soon as possible."

The 16-times grand slam champion suffered a five-set loss to U.S. Open champion Novak Djokovic in the semi-finals at Flushing Meadows before arriving in Australia to aid Switzerland`s return to the Davis Cup World Group.

"I have very fond memories of Shanghai so I will miss this amazing tournament and all my loyal Chinese fans, but I look forward to returning to China next fall," said Federer.
